What a Post-Renovation Clean Covers

Renovation dust and residue settle differently than everyday mess — your cleaner works through each of these before a final walkthrough.

Drywall Dust Removal

Fine drywall dust is pervasive after renovation work — it settles into vents, light fixtures, and every horizontal surface. Your cleaner works room by room to clear it, not just the visible layer.

Paint Splatter & Overspray Removal

Paint splatter and overspray on trim, floors, and fixtures gets carefully removed without damaging finished surfaces.

Sticker & Label Removal

Protective stickers and manufacturer labels on new fixtures, appliances, and windows are peeled off and any adhesive residue is cleaned.

Construction Debris Removal

Leftover packaging, offcuts, and fine debris from the finishing stage are cleared from every room your cleaner covers.

Window Track & Sill Cleaning

New or replaced windows collect installation dust and residue in the tracks and sills — these get detailed, not just wiped.

Light Fixture & Vent Cleaning

New light fixtures and HVAC vents are dusted and wiped down to clear installation residue before you move back in.

Protective Floor Film Removal

Protective film and paper used during construction is removed from finished flooring, and the floor underneath is cleaned.

Cabinet Interior Wipe-Down

New or refinished cabinets get an interior wipe-down to clear dust before you start putting items away.

Renovation Projects We Clean After

From condo refreshes to full new-build closings, the finishing-stage mess is different every time — but the cleanup approach stays consistent.

Condo Renovation Completions

Condo renovations in Toronto high-rises often require building management approval and a certificate of insurance (COI) from your contractor before work begins — the same access rules usually apply to your post-reno cleaning visit. Tell us your building's booking window and COI requirement at checkout.

New-Build & Subdivision Closings

New-build subdivisions finishing construction in Vaughan and Markham leave fine drywall dust and installation residue throughout the home before closing. A post-renovation clean gets the home ready before move-in.

Laneway House & Basement Completions

Laneway house completions and basement renovation completions across Toronto involve the same finishing-stage residue as a full home renovation — drywall dust, paint splatter, and leftover fixtures packaging — even in a smaller footprint.

Book your post-renovation cleaning once the contractor has finished work and cleared major debris — Houmse handles the fine dust, residue, and detail cleaning left behind, not construction waste removal. This applies to new-build subdivision closings in Vaughan and Markham, laneway house completions, and basement renovation completions alike.
